13.11.1
Amplifier output offset variation
The offset is quite sensitive to temperature variations. In order to ensure a good reliability in
measurements, the offset must be recalibrated periodically i.e. during power on or whenever
the device is reset depending on the customer application and during temperature variation.
Table 87 gives the typical offset variation over temperature.
